Java工程師如何下載MySQL jar包

一、為什麼需要下載MySQL jar包

在使用Java作為後端語言時,經常需要操作資料庫,而MySQL是一種廣泛使用的關係型資料庫,所以我們需要下載MySQL的驅動程序,即MySQL jar包。 MySQL jar包中包含了Java程序調用MySQL資料庫的相關方法和類,使得Java程序能夠連接、查詢、修改、刪除MySQL中的數據。

二、從官網下載MySQL jar包

在官方網站(https://dev.mysql.com/downloads/connector/j/)上找到MySQL Connector/J。選擇自己需要的版本後,下載對應平台(Windows、Mac、Linux等)的jar包,解壓縮後可以得到一個mysql-connector-java-5.1.0-bin.jar文件,這個文件就是我們所需要的MySQL驅動包。如果需要使用新版的MySQL Connector/J 8.0,則需要進行註冊並登錄,才能進行下載。

//在pom.xml里添加依賴:
<dependency>
   <groupId>mysql</groupId>
   <artifactId>mysql-connector-java</artifactId>
   <version>8.0.11</version>
</dependency>

三、從Maven倉庫中導入MySQL jar包

Maven是Java世界中用來管理依賴關係的工具,可以自動下載指定的jar包,也可以自動解決相關依賴關係。如果我們使用Maven,就可以利用Maven直接從Maven倉庫中導入MySQL的jar包,而不需要手動下載。

//在pom.xml里添加依賴:
<dependency>
   <groupId>mysql</groupId>
   <artifactId>mysql-connector-java</artifactId>
   <version>8.0.11</version>
</dependency>

四、在Eclipse中添加MySQL驅動程序

在Eclipse中,可以按以下步驟添加MySQL驅動程序:

1、在Eclipse工程中,右鍵點擊工程名,選擇「Properties」

2、在左側菜單中,選擇「Java Build Path」,然後切換到「Libraries」選項卡

3、點擊「Add External JARs」按鈕,選擇已下載好的MySQL 驅動jar包並點擊「Open」

4、在「Libraries」中會出現剛添加的MySQL驅動,點擊「Apply」按鈕生效即可

//在Eclipse中連接Mysql資料庫的示例代碼:
Class.forName("com.mysql.jdbc.Driver");   //載入資料庫驅動
Connection conn = DriverManager.getConnection(鏈接地址, 用戶名, 密碼);   //連接資料庫
Statement stmt = conn.createStatement();   //創建SQL語句執行對象
String sql = "SELECT * FROM xx_table";   //SQL語句
ResultSet rs = stmt.executeQuery(sql);   //執行查詢語句,結果存放在rs中
while(rs.next()){   //while循環遍歷結果集
    System.out.println(rs.getString("columnName"));
}
conn.close();   //關閉資料庫連接

五、在IntelliJ IDEA中添加MySQL驅動程序

在IntelliJ IDEA中,可以按以下步驟添加MySQL驅動程序:

1. 打開IDEA工程,選擇File→Project Structure。

2. 在彈出窗口的左側選擇「Modules」,然後在右側的「Dependencies」欄中選擇「+」」→「JARs or directories」。

3. 選擇已下載好的MySQL 驅動jar包並點擊「Apply」按鈕生效即可。

六、通過Gradle下載MySQL jar包

Gradle是一款基於Apache Ant和Apache Maven概念的項目自動化構建工具。下面是用Gradle構建Java工程,在build.gradle文件中添加MySQL jar包的依賴:

dependencies {
    compile group: 'mysql', name: 'mysql-connector-java', version: '5.1.6'
}

七、總結

Java開發中需要使用MySQL資料庫驅動,能夠方便的進行資料庫操作。我們可以通過從官網下載MySQL jar包、從Maven倉庫中導入MySQL jar包、在Eclipse中添加MySQL驅動程序、在IntelliJ IDEA中添加MySQL驅動程序、通過Gradle下載MySQL jar包等多種方式來獲得相應的MySQL jar包。選擇適合自己的方法,能夠讓我們更加快速便捷地進行Java開發中的相關工作。

原創文章,作者:XYNI,如若轉載,請註明出處:https://www.506064.com/zh-tw/n/140495.html

(0)
打賞 微信掃一掃 微信掃一掃 支付寶掃一掃 支付寶掃一掃
XYNI的頭像XYNI
上一篇 2024-10-04 00:23
下一篇 2024-10-04 00:23

相關推薦

  • java client.getacsresponse 編譯報錯解決方法

    java client.getacsresponse 編譯報錯是Java編程過程中常見的錯誤,常見的原因是代碼的語法錯誤、類庫依賴問題和編譯環境的配置問題。下面將從多個方面進行分析…

    編程 2025-04-29
  • Java JsonPath 效率優化指南

    本篇文章將深入探討Java JsonPath的效率問題,並提供一些優化方案。 一、JsonPath 簡介 JsonPath是一個可用於從JSON數據中獲取信息的庫。它提供了一種DS…

    編程 2025-04-29
  • 如何修改mysql的埠號

    本文將介紹如何修改mysql的埠號,方便開發者根據實際需求配置對應埠號。 一、為什麼需要修改mysql埠號 默認情況下,mysql使用的埠號是3306。在某些情況下,我們需…

    編程 2025-04-29
  • Java Bean載入過程

    Java Bean載入過程涉及到類載入器、反射機制和Java虛擬機的執行過程。在本文中,將從這三個方面詳細闡述Java Bean載入的過程。 一、類載入器 類載入器是Java虛擬機…

    編程 2025-04-29
  • Java騰訊雲音視頻對接

    本文旨在從多個方面詳細闡述Java騰訊雲音視頻對接,提供完整的代碼示例。 一、騰訊雲音視頻介紹 騰訊雲音視頻服務(Cloud Tencent Real-Time Communica…

    編程 2025-04-29
  • Java Milvus SearchParam withoutFields用法介紹

    本文將詳細介紹Java Milvus SearchParam withoutFields的相關知識和用法。 一、什麼是Java Milvus SearchParam without…

    編程 2025-04-29
  • Java 8中某一周的周一

    Java 8是Java語言中的一個版本,於2014年3月18日發布。本文將從多個方面對Java 8中某一周的周一進行詳細的闡述。 一、數組處理 Java 8新特性之一是Stream…

    編程 2025-04-29
  • Java判斷字元串是否存在多個

    本文將從以下幾個方面詳細闡述如何使用Java判斷一個字元串中是否存在多個指定字元: 一、字元串遍歷 字元串是Java編程中非常重要的一種數據類型。要判斷字元串中是否存在多個指定字元…

    編程 2025-04-29
  • VSCode為什麼無法運行Java

    解答:VSCode無法運行Java是因為默認情況下,VSCode並沒有集成Java運行環境,需要手動添加Java運行環境或安裝相關插件才能實現Java代碼的編寫、調試和運行。 一、…

    編程 2025-04-29
  • Java任務下發回滾系統的設計與實現

    本文將介紹一個Java任務下發回滾系統的設計與實現。該系統可以用於執行複雜的任務,包括可回滾的任務,及時恢復任務失敗前的狀態。系統使用Java語言進行開發,可以支持多種類型的任務。…

    編程 2025-04-29

發表回復

登錄後才能評論